How far is GPI from TAT?

The flight distance from Guapi (GPI) to Poprad (TAT) is 6,451 miles (10,382 km, 5,606 nautical miles), measured along the great-circle route airlines actually fly.

How long is the flight from GPI to TAT?

A nonstop flight takes about 13h 7m gate to gate. Actual time varies with winds, routing and season — eastbound transatlantic flights, for example, are usually faster than the return.

What is the time difference between Guapi and Poprad?

Poprad is 7 hours ahead of Guapi.
